The commercial market throughout the Hills District has a strong demand for specialist electrical knowledge. Norwest Service Park continues to be among Sydney's premier commercial precincts, housing both national and worldwide companies that rely on a reliable, constant power supply. Medical practices, childcare centers, physical fitness clubs, dining establishments, and stores scattered throughout Castle Hill, Bella Vista, and Baulkham Hills all need electrical work that fulfills the particular guidelines for commercial and public places in NSW. This covers emergency lighting, certified exit signs, three‑phase power installations, safety assessments, and data‑communication cabling capable of supporting today's service needs. Electrical company in the Hills District who serve the commercial sector should also excel at dealing with tasks that can not tolerate substantial downtime, arranging their jobs around service hours and operational restrictions to limit disturbance. The ability to plan, carry out, and file commercial electrical tasks to the approval of building certifiers and council inspectors distinguishes the most proficient companies in the local market.
Energy performance and eco-friendly innovations now dominate the discussion surrounding Electrical Services in the Hills District, and specialists are being tasked with conference these expectations. Across the area, more house owners are opting for solar installations, battery‑storage units, and electric‑vehicle charging stations as and lower dependence on the grid. Properly installing these services requires a solid grasp of switchboard capacity, load‑assessment calculations, inverter matching, and the network standards imposed by regional energy suppliers. In addition to green power, smart‑home systems have become a significant component of the Hills District's electrical landscape, with locals in suburban areas such as Glenhaven and West Pennant Hills commissioning totally integrated setups that let them manage lighting, climate, security and home entertainment from one interface. Eventually, the value of engaging more info expert Electrical Services Hills District providers comes down to safety, compliance, and the long-lasting efficiency of your residential or commercial property's electrical systems. Every piece of electrical work performed in NSW must be accompanied by a Certificate of Compliance released by the licenced specialist responsible for the job, and this documents is essential for insurance coverage purposes and future residential or commercial property deals. Cutting corners by engaging unlicensed operators or attempting to perform restricted electrical work without certifications produces risks that far outweigh any short-term cost savings.
